Transaction ade5b175738ae28bba561dfda7722b8bfe920097c878a7d4c2070c9936e0a124

1 Input
1 Outputs
  • ade5b175738ae28bba561dfda7722b8bfe920097c878a7d4c2070c9936e0a124:0
  • value  543549
    address  3HKAEnfXNnqJm2UeNu57KXv6wEt45ApFUp